Pick 3, Pick 4, and Pick 5: Daily Chances for Ohio Lottery Players

For those who enjoy more frequent drawings, the Pick 3, Pick 4, and Pick 5 games offer twice-daily chances to win. The Pick 3 evening winning number for Sunday was 279, with the midday number being 397. Pick 4’s evening number was 1225, and the midday number was 7449. Pick 5’s evening number was 98233, and the midday number was 96379. A $1 straight bet on Pick 3 pays $500, with odds of about one in 1,000. Pick 4 pays $5,000 for a $1 straight bet, with odds of one in 10,000. Pick 5 offers even larger payouts, and the odds are more challenging, but the excitement of daily drawings keeps players coming back. These daily games and their frequent winners are a staple of the Ohio Lottery experience.

How Ohio Lottery Drawings Work and When to Play

The Ohio Lottery offers a variety of games with different drawing schedules. Pick 3, Pick 4, and Pick 5 drawings occur twice daily at approximately 12:29 p.m. and 7:29 p.m. Rolling Cash Five draws nightly at 7:35 p.m. Classic Lotto draws on Mondays, Wednesdays, and Saturdays at 7:05 p.m. Lucky for Life draws nightly at 10:30 p.m. Powerball draws on Mondays, Wednesdays, and Saturdays at 10:59 p.m., while Mega Millions draws on Tuesdays and Fridays at 11 p.m. Knowing the drawing times and the game schedules helps players plan their purchases and increases the excitement as results are announced.

Odds and Payouts: What Ohio Lottery Players Should Know

Understanding the odds is important for anyone playing the lottery. The odds of winning the Powerball jackpot are about one in 292,201,338 per $2 ticket, while Mega Millions jackpot odds are about one in 290,472,336 per $5 ticket. Classic Lotto offers better odds at about one in 13,983,816 per $1 ticket. Rolling Cash Five has odds of about one in 575,757, and Lucky for Life’s top prize odds are about one in 30,821,472 per $2 ticket. Pick 3 and Pick 4 offer much better odds for smaller prizes. These odds and payouts help players make informed choices and understand the risks and rewards of each game.
